They did not stop making peanut M&Ms.

Peanut M&Ms are still being made and have not been discontinued.

The peanut M&Ms are still a regular and popular variety of M&Ms.

Peanut M&Ms are still widely available online and in many stores and come in various sizes as well as in different colors for holidays and other celebrations.

Peanut M&Ms were also first introduced in the year of 1954 and are still a staple product today.

The peanut M&Ms are available at many stores including Walmart and Costco.

And the M&Ms website also offers options for customizing the Peanut M&Ms with specific color combinations for different events.

Peanut M&Ms and other M&Ms are made by Mars, Incorporated, who is a multinational company that owns M&M brand through it's Mars Wrigley Confectionery division.

The company was also founded by Forrest Mars, Sr., and the "M's" in M&Ms stand for the last names of Forest Mars and Bruce Murrie, who are the people that created M&M candy.
